**Alert: Verdigris template rendering latency**

This alert triggers when p95 render time for Verdigris templates exceeds 800ms over five minutes. For security review purposes: slow renders can indicate template injection attempts or unbounded loop expressions from untrusted input, so spikes warrant a look at recent template submissions. Sandbox limits are enforced in the renderer config. For access to render logs or sandbox settings, contact the platform team here.

escalation mailbox, bafog-fafog: ulador@paliqlabs.internal

PickFlow Recovery — On-call

If the optimizer service account locks after three failed batch auths, do not reset via console. Stop the pick-list scheduler first, drain queued waves, then trigger recovery from the Lanework admin node. Confirm warehouse sync is paused in Zone B before proceeding. Recovery requires the passphrase held by the rotation lead; verify it matches the vault copy. Use the passphrase below to complete the unlock.

vault phrase of tajeg-tageg = pelix-druix-holius-briael-zorwyn-frawyn-fraox-norok-drueth-aldiel

## Inventory Reconciliation Job — Plugin Authors

The Marrowlane reconciliation job runs nightly, diffing warehouse counts against the Tindervale ledger. Plugins hook the post-diff stage only; do not mutate counts upstream. Register your plugin manifest before the 0200 window or it will be skipped. All plugin calls back into the Tindervale API are authenticated with the shared reconciliation key, injected at runtime. For local testing against the staging ledger, use the key that follows.

gateway credential: kto7_GoY89Me

Ticket: Staging env misconfigured for Siftgate bloom filter

The bloom layer in front of the Pellet KV store is rejecting all lookups in staging because the env file was copied from the dev template without credentials. False-positive tuning values are fine; only the auth line is missing. To unblock the weekly demo, the Pellet admission secret must be set on the following line.

env line for yaguf-fajop: LEDGER_TOKEN13=fb08984397349